Double pane windows consist of two glass panes separated by a space that is filled with air or other insulating gasses like argon. When these windows get misty, it means that the seal has failed and the window needs to be replaced.

Condensation occurs when warm air comes into contact with cold surfaces and impermeable like windows. It occurs because humidity gets attracted by cooler air and forms on the surface of windows. This moisture can cause fogging or misting to develop on the windows' interiors making them difficult to view.

A double-glazed window is made up of two glass panes, separated by a spacer bar. The gap is then filled with a non-conductive gas, like argon to create an effective barrier to keep cold air out and warm air coming into your home. This helps you maintain an even temperature throughout your home and prevent heat loss. The window is then sealed around the edges to form an airtight seal, which will increase insulation.

A reputable installer will provide a long-term guarantee, usually a minimum of 10 years, though some companies offer a lifetime guarantee. Be sure to find out the terms of the guarantee and when, and if any work on your doors or windows are excluded from the guarantee. Find out what happens when your window doesn't perform as it is supposed to. Many buyers of double glazing have issues with their door or window mechanisms, but these issues can be fixed. It's usually a matter of lubricating the mechanism, the hinges, or the places where they go through frames (if it's windows with sash) to determine if this resolves the issue.

If your window has a blown seal, it indicates that moisture is leaking between the glass panes and this can result in condensation, draughts or even let air from outside to enter your home. It is important to get it fixed as early as you can as a leaky window can increase your heating or cooling costs by up to 20 percent each year.

If you live in a conservation zone or have an historic building that is listed, it may be possible to remove the windows you have in place and replace them with replacements of the same style, as long as they meet the minimum energy efficiency requirements set out in Building Regulations. In other cases, you'll need find a joiner or metal worker who has worked on buildings that are historic and have an understanding of the requirements to fit new windows of a different style.
